Abstract

The utility model provides a rotary wheel closing device, which comprises a rotary wheel shaft 1 and a rotary wheel 2. The rotary wheel shaft 1 comprises a shaft end 10 and a lug boss 11; the outer circle of the shaft end 10 is tapped; the rotary wheel 2 comprises a first concave part 4, a through hole 6 and a second concave part 9; a thread 5 is machined on the inner wall of the through hole 6; the thread is matched with a tap on the outer circle of the shaft end 10 of the rotary wheel shaft; the first concave part 4 is matched with the lug boss 11; and the outer circle of the shaft end 10, the thread 5 on the inner wall of the through hole 6, the first concave part 4 and the lug boss 11 are jointly matched, so as to guarantee the vertical precision of the rotary wheel and the rotary wheel shaft. The rotary wheel closing device further comprises a self-locking nut and an inner thread of the self-locking nut is matched with the tap on the outer circle of the shaft end 10; and in an assembling process, the self-locking nut is tightly contacted with the second concave part 9. The rotary wheel and the rotary wheel shaft are connected by adopting the thread and a locking screw nut is additionally arranged, so that the reliability is high; and the rotary wheel and the rotary wheel shaft are convenient to detach and the work strength of maintenance personnel is relieved.

Background technology
It is the visual plant that the CNG gas cylinder is produced that the TWH425 spinning roller is received end closing-up machine, and digital control system is controlled the hydraulic drive spinning roller and pressed the track operation, product is carried out heat fusion processing close up or receive the end.Its spinning roller assembling, operating position directly affect product quality and product percent of pass.
The operation principle that adopts spinning roller to close up is: the steel billet through material conveying mechanism heats or not heating is delivered in turn-down rig V-type groove, the action of stirring cylinder advance put in place after, the clamping walking mechanism clamps steel billet and delivers in the main shaft chuck.The discharging cylinder is in retracted position, and the steel billet top is by discharging cylinder discharging location.The clamping cylinder action makes the clamping bottle base of chuck, the input and output material cylinder is return original position, motor drives main shaft and steel billet rotation by belt, die cylinder rotates mould and steel billet is closed up or receive end moulding, mould is return original position, clamping cylinder unclamps jaw, and drawing mechanism is released main shaft in turn-down rig V-type groove with the pipe of moulding, and the stirring cylinder action is routed up steel billet.
Existing spinning roller is to adopt 12 M14*75 high-strength hexagon socket-head bolts to be connected with spinning roller axle connected mode, and its defective is as follows:
1, due to spinning roller and spinning roller axle mating surface precision is high, spinning roller heavy (approximately 100kg), connect with 12 bolts, assembling is difficult.
2, spinning roller in the course of the work, the very large and high temperature of spinning roller and product extruding force, bolt is yielding under Tensile and twisting action power, elongation, spinning roller and spinning roller axle are easily loosening, work a period of time is broken, and be difficult to take out by the bolt broken, also need use in case of necessity electric drill, the screwed hole on the spinning roller axle also must tapping etc. series of problems.
3, former spinning roller and spinning roller axle are connected to that the 12-M14*75 high-strength hexagon socket-head bolt is connected, the spinning roller pilot hole is of a size of ¢ 140H7, spinning roller axle assembling spinning roller place is that ¢ 140k6 belongs to interference fits, it has only guaranteed that spinning roller and spinning roller axle reach the assembly technology requirement, mainly by the link of 12-M14*75 high-strength hexagon socket-head bolt.Be product processing work point in product processing due to spinning roller edge ¢ 500 arc surface places, its extruding force is very large, suffered force direction is 45 degree circular arc tangential line directions, cause bolt to be subjected to pulling force to produce that deformation (reason of expanding with heat and contract with cold in addition), spinning roller and beam warp are normal to be become flexible and be difficult for discovering, cause converted products defective, and repair, the refitting workload is large, affect production efficiency, refitting causes spinning roller and the assembling of spinning roller axle do not reach requirement and scrap often, causes unnecessary loss (changing 1.1 ten thousand yuan of spinning rollers, 0.8 ten thousand yuan, axle).
The connectivity problem that solves spinning roller and spinning roller axle becomes and improves the major issue that the TWH425 spinning roller is received end closing-up machine utilization rate of equipment and installations and product quality.
Summary of the invention
In order to address the above problem, the utility model proposes a kind of new spinning roller closing device, spinning roller adopts with spinning roller axle itself and is threaded, and adds lock nut, and reliability is high, and spinning roller and spinning roller axle easy accessibility alleviate maintenance personal's working strength.
the technical solution of the utility model is: a kind of spinning roller closing device, it is characterized in that, comprise spinning roller axle 1 and spinning roller 2, described spinning roller axle 1 comprises axle head 10 and boss 11, tapping on the cylindrical of described axle head 10, described spinning roller 2 comprises the first recess 4, through hole 6 and the second recess 9, the inwall of through hole 6 is processed as screw thread 5, tapping coupling on axle head 10 cylindricals of this screw thread and above-mentioned spinning roller axle, described the first recess 4 and boss 11 couplings, the cylindrical of axle head 10, screw thread 5 on through hole 6 inwalls, the first recess 4 and boss 11 coordinate jointly, guarantee the vertical precision of spinning roller and spinning roller axle.
Described spinning roller closing device further comprises Self-lock nut, the tapping coupling on the cylindrical of its internal thread and described axle head 10, Self-lock nut and the second recess 9 close contacts during assembling.
Described spinning roller closing device is characterized in that, through hole 6 processes are ¢ 140, and screw thread 5 is processed as the M144*2 screw thread.
Described spinning roller closing device is characterized in that, the cylindrical of axle head 10 is ¢ 144, processing M144*2 screw thread on this cylindrical.
Described spinning roller closing device is characterized in that, boss 11 processes are ¢ 205f8, and the process of the first recess 4 is ¢ 205H7.
Described spinning roller closing device is characterized in that, the Self-lock nut external diameter is that ¢ 200, the second recess 9 processes are ¢ 280.
Described spinning roller closing device is characterized in that, spinning roller and spinning roller axle positioning accuracy when assembling is 8 grades.
Described spinning roller closing device is characterized in that, opens the screwed hole of 2 M16 on the spinning roller axle.
Described spinning roller closing device is characterized in that, opens the fabrication hole of 4 M10 on spinning roller.

The specific embodiment
As shown in Fig. 1-5, a kind of spinning roller closing device, comprise spinning roller axle 1 and spinning roller 2, described spinning roller axle 1 comprises axle head 10 and boss 11, on the cylindrical of described axle head 10, tapping 7, described spinning roller 2 comprises the first recess 4, through hole 6 and the second recess 9, the inwall of through hole 6 is processed as screw thread 5, tapping coupling on axle head 10 cylindricals of this screw thread and above-mentioned spinning roller axle, described the first recess 4 and boss 11 couplings, the screw thread 5 on the cylindrical of axle head 10, through hole 6 inwalls, the first recess 4 and boss 11 coordinate jointly, guarantee the vertical precision of spinning roller and spinning roller axle.
As Fig. 1 and Fig. 6, shown in Figure 7, be connected with the spinning roller axle due to spinning roller and adopt the screw thread interlink, may occur becoming flexible under the active forces such as external force, vibration, high temperature being subjected to, install Self-lock nut 3 additional for this reason, the Self-lock nut external diameter is ¢ 200, tapping coupling on the cylindrical of its internal thread and described axle head 10, Self-lock nut and the second recess 9 close contacts during assembling.As Fig. 6, shown in Figure 7, be evenly arranged 8 flutings on this Self-lock nut excircle, the angle between adjacent fluting is 45 degree.
As preferred embodiment, through hole 6 is ¢ 140, and screw thread 5 is processed as the M144*2 screw thread; The cylindrical of axle head 10 is ¢ 144, processing M144*2 screw thread on this cylindrical; Boss 11 processes are ¢ 205f8, and the process of the first recess 4 is ¢ 205H7; The Self-lock nut external diameter is ¢ 200; The second recess 9 processes are ¢ 280.
During assembling, spinning roller and spinning roller axle positioning accuracy are 8 grades; Prevent the rotation of spinning roller axle, open the screwed hole 8 of 2 M16 on the spinning roller axle, play fixation, as shown in Figure 5; When the loading and unloading spinning roller, dismounting for convenience of spinning roller, open the silk hole 12 of 12 M16 on spinning roller, as shown in Figure 3, Figure 4,12 silk holes evenly distribute, angle between adjacent two holes is 15 degree, and Inner fills Inner hexagonal flush end holding screw M16*45 and reaches certain moment when spinning roller and spinning roller axle are seated close contact, and is for convenience detach.
The implication of above symbol ¢ 200, ¢ 140, ¢ 280, M144*2, ¢ 205f8, ¢ 205H7, M16*45, M16 is the size marking basic meaning in National Standard of Mechanical Drawing.
